Program tracking online employees time? VVVVV where are you???

Okay I already have a program where my sales people can log in and out, however that doesn't mean they are REALLY sitting at their computer working.

Anyone know of a program that would log their time available by activity? Like if they were inactive on their computer for 10 minutes or more it would stop logging their time?

If not already I wonder if I could have this built as my own little download for my company. Can't be TOO hard, right?

I have used ActivTrak before for monitoring remote agents. I found it super helpful and it gave reports on where they were spending their time so I could help improve their efficiency.

It also took screenshots and monitored keywords they entered which was helpful as we had some strict guidelines as to what could and couldn't be said.

Yes - holy big brother batman - but it was very helpful as a training tool and I made the agents aware we were monitoring and would share the graphs, reports, etc so they could improve their effectiveness. ActivTrak is literally invisible so I didn't have to, I approached it from the perspective of training.

I'd start my sessions by asking "do you want a raise?" when they said the inevitable yes, I'd share the reports and data from ActivTrak to illustrate how they could make more. There wasn't a penalty for spending 50% of their time on facebook instead of porn (as long as they were making their minimum), I'd simply say "only spend 25% of your time on facebook and more time on GFY and you'll make more money!" ;)

Most often they were astonished by how much time they spent on unproductive sites and found the process very helpful.
